How Do Number Lines Help Improve Math Skills?

Number lines can improve maths skills in several ways:

  • Number lines provide a visual representation of numbers, making it easier for students to understand counting, addition, and subtraction. Seeing the numbers in a spatial arrangement can help students better understand the relationships between numbers.
  • Number lines can also help students with estimation skills. By placing a number on a number line, students can see the distance between that number and other numbers. This can help them make estimates when doing mental arithmetic or solving problems.
  • Number lines can be beneficial when working with fractions. By dividing a number line into equal parts, students can visualise fractions and understand their relationships to other fractions and whole numbers.
  • Number lines can also help students with operations such as multiplication and division. For example, multiplying by a whole number can be visualised as repeatedly jumping along the number line by the value of the multiplier.
